Clean Energy Fund, Data and Fund Performance Manager (Analyst IV)
NEOGOV is seeking a Data and Fund Performance Manager for the Portland Clean Energy Community Benefits Fund (PCEF) at the Bureau of Planning and Sustainability. This role involves strategic leadership in managing data systems, driving analytics efforts, and ensuring transparent reporting for climate action investments. The successful candidate will oversee a team to implement programs and projects aimed at reducing greenhouse gas emissions and advancing social justice.

Responsibilities
Build and strengthen PCEF’s data systems and reporting infrastructure:
Partner with BPS’s Technical Services team to shape and implement data systems and workflows that meet PCEF program needs
Help design practical, user-friendly data collection methods and reporting tools that support accurate, timely, and consistent data
Work closely with program staff and external partners to ensure data requirements and systems are clear, effective, and aligned across programs
Guide high-level analysis and research:
Direct high-level analysis and query development for strategic leadership guidance in implementing the Climate Investment Plan
Set analysis priorities and oversee day-to-day performance analysis delivered by staff, ensuring consistency, quality, applicability, and timely delivery
Plan and oversee research initiatives with partners such as PSU and the National Renewable Labs to identify and implement successful climate strategies
Manage staff:
Supervise and mentor at least one assigned staff member, setting clear performance expectations and development goals
Provide day-to-day direction for at least three PCEF-assigned staff on the Technical Services team (in coordination with the Technical Services supervisor) to ensure priorities, timelines, and deliverables stay aligned
Evaluate staff performance and support professional growth
Oversee program evaluation:
Create evaluation plans and timelines, and oversee implementation of evaluations across PCEF program areas, in partnership with program content leads
Guide procurement and management of subject matter focused evaluation consultants
Promote continuous improvement by using evaluation results to strengthen program design and implementation
Serve as a key leader in a growing program:
Participate actively on PCEF leadership and management teams
Help shape standards, practices, and norms for how PCEF measures results, tells its story, and stays accountable to equitable community outcomes as the program scales
Qualification
Required
At least 5 years experience designing and leading complex program or process evaluations including data governance or data management processes
Experience developing sound decisions, conclusions, and recommendations, especially in high pressure situations
Experience working with technical staff to translate business needs into data and technology processes, systems and products
Ability to lead, manage, supervise, train, and conduct performance measurement design and evaluations
Ability to collaborate with communities of color and people traditionally underrepresented in local decision-making
Preferred
Management experience working for a public agency
